This recipe is very good, it has a unique flavour. Like another user said, I used regular balsamic vinegar instead of white, only because I didn't have white at home. I also crushed some onion flakes instead of using onion powder. I used 2 tspn crushed chili pepper and omitted the green onions (didn't have any). I followed another user's advice and used the left over marinade as a sauce by boiling the marinade and adding a tspn of cornstarch.

This dish is so delicious!!! I love salmon, and this is one of the best recipes. I have to say it is great broiled, but it is simply wonderful on the grill. I marinated the whole fillet with the skin and put it on some foil and it was great.***Update***I used some leftovers to make salmon patties & it was out of this world! Simply mix with seasoned bread crumbs, beaten egg, diced onion, green peppers, spices & brown in the skillet. Excellent!
